Very comfortable rooms in a stylish complex set in a secure compound. There is a dining courtyard beside the adjacent Mercure Hotel which is a pleasant place to sit and relax.
The hotel is a little inconveniently located, though, and you'd need a car or to take taxis to get into the city centre.
Also, be aware that it is not beside the main international airport, but next to a domestic terminal catering to Cessnas and the like. This error didn't affect me, as I had a vehicle, but if you are relying on walking to the international airport in the morning, you'll have a problem as it's 37 kilometres away.
Also, don't order the Caesar Salad - the chef put so much dressing on the lettuce that it was a ghastly soggy mess.
Overall, highly recommended.
